ProsThough it's called a cream, it's actually an ampoule balm product. It even says 'ampoule balm' on the case. Since it's a balm well-infused with ampoule, it absorbs much more smoothly than other balm products. Just like a cream.
You can think of it as a nourishing cream. When you first apply it and massage your face, it feels a bit stiff, but after a little rubbing, your skin becomes wonderfully firm and supple.
I have combination dehydrated skin, so I don't use it daily, but I apply it when my skin feels dry, and I haven't experienced any blemishes.
By the way, I'm sharing this with my mother.
ConsIf you consider it as a balm, it absorbs quite smoothly. However, if you think of it as a cream, it's a bit on the thick side.
TipTry spreading it thinly and really massaging it into your face. It stays moisturizing for a long time like a massage cream, making it great for facial massages.
